" I've got an inboard outboard 165hp mercruser that keeps stalling when you
go from neutral into gear. I understand it may be the shift cable. A neutral switch or something. Any Ideas???? Are there any adjustments on the cable that could solve the problem????" Check the adjustment of the "shift interrupter switch", it's purpose is to kill the ignition for a moment when you shift into forward or reverse to make the gear engagement easier. Check the adjustment with engine NOT running. Move remote control shift handle to full reverse while turning propeller shaft clockwise until shaft stops, ensuring full clutch engagement. The switch should be in the center of it's slot. If not, adjust the remote control shifter cable 1 turn at a time (4 turns maximum) toward the end guide. |
